Bulgaria Requests to Enter Germany's Group of NATO Framework Nations

Caretaker Defense Minister Velizar Shalamanov has sent a letter to German counterpart Ursula von der Leyen to voice Bulgaria's willingness to join NATO's concept of "framework nations".
The move was announced by the Defense Ministry's press office.
Under the concept, nations are encouraged to voluntarily form groups and use them to create a common platform for maintenance and upgrade of military capabilities.
It also envisages that leading Alliance members should grant a "framework" for the other states within which the latter should pursue deeper development of certain specific elements.
The concept should provide allies with a tool to manage more efficiently those priority capabilities that should be at NATO's disposal.
Shalamanov has proposed that Bulgaria enter the group led by Germany.
He believes the country could contribute in areas such as joint preparation and military drills, participation in command and headquarter structures for planning and conducting NATO operations and medical teams.
